OUTSTANDING YOUNG MANUFACTURING ENGINEER AWARD

​

 

Award Description

The Outstanding Young Manufacturing Engineer Award recognizes manufacturing engineers, age 35 or younger, who have made exceptional contributions and accomplishments in the manufacturing industry.

Nominees can be selected by the Society's International Awards & Recognition Committee based on a single outstanding accomplishment, such as technical publications, patents, academic or industry leadership or for several significant accomplishments in one or more areas of activity.

Eligibility Requirements

Nominees must be:

  1. Age 35 or younger on August 1 of the year of their nomination

  2. A graduate or non-graduate engineer or technologist

  3. The Outstanding Young Manufacturing Engineer Award is open to both national and international citizens.

Nomination Guide

  • Complete the nomination form as thoroughly as possible, with as much supporting information as possible.

  • Verify that the nominee meets all necessary eligibility requirements outlined above and on the nomination form.

  • Include two letters of recommendation, preferably on letterhead, one of which can be submitted by the nominator, which briefly highlight the nominee’s accomplishments. Note: Self-nominations and/or submissions will not be accepted.

  • Have an additional, unbiased person proofread your nomination.

  • Enclose the nominee’s CV or résumé. All nominations must include one of these forms of career histories.

  • Send the completed nomination form, two letters of recommendation and either a CV or résumé no later than August 1 of each year to:
